Therapeutic Approaches and Online Care
Jaisen Thomas draws on evidence-informed methods to help clients address a range of concerns.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, or CBT, focuses on identifying and shifting unhelpful thoughts and behaviors to reduce symptoms of anxiety, depression, and stress and to build practical coping skills. Dialectical Behavior Therapy, or DBT, teaches emotion regulation, distress tolerance, and interpersonal effectiveness skills to help people manage intense feelings and improve relationships. The Gottman Method offers structured tools for couples to improve communication, resolve conflict, and strengthen emotional connection.Choosing the right approach is part of the therapeutic process, and Thomas works collaboratively with each person to determine what fits best based on their needs, goals, and preferences. He adapts strategies over time so clients receive approaches that feel most helpful.
